Overview
This Flat-plate Cylindrical Lens Array is a planar diffractive element that performs one-dimensional beam shaping and homogenization. An array of cylindrical microlenses is patterned into a liquid crystal polymer (LCP) film sandwiched between two N-BK7 window plates; the arrayed radial phase distribution provides the cylindrical optical power. Each cylindrical lenslet spans a unit footprint of 1 mmx25.4 mm across the Ø25.4 mm substrate, so the overall element diameter refers to the full plate — not to a single lenslet. The single-wavelength design is free of spherical aberration, and depending on the incident circular-polarization handedness the array yields a converging or diverging output. This unit operates at 976 nm with a per-lenslet focal length of 5 mm.

Construction & Performance
The array has a flat plate form (overall thickness 3.2 mm) with no ground curved surface: the cylindrical power of every lenslet is produced by the graded orientation of the liquid crystal molecules, enabling micron-level fabrication precision together with large dispersion. An anti-reflection coating on the incident surface supports high transmittance and diffraction efficiency. Key specifications for this model:
- Optical element diameter: Ø25.4 mm
- Thickness: 3.2 mm
- Operating Wavelength: 976 nm
- Focal Length: 5 mm
- Clear Aperture: Ø21.5 mm
- Microlens unit size: 1 mmx25.4 mm
- Substrate Material: N-BK7/ Liquid Crystal Polymer
- Diffraction Efficiency: >98%
- Surface Quality (Scratch/Dig): 60/40
- AR Coating: Ravg<0.5% @700-1100 nm
- Transmittance: >98%
- Operating Temperature: -20 deg C to 60 deg C
Storage & Handling
Handle the element by its edges and avoid contact with the clear aperture. Keep the optical surfaces free of dust and fingerprints; when cleaning is needed, use clean optical-grade solvents and lens tissue. Note the orientation of the lenslet axis when mounting so the shaped line lies in the intended plane. Store in the original container in a clean, dry environment within the rated operating temperature range, away from direct sunlight, condensation and corrosive vapors.
